Text copied to clipboard!

Tytuł

Text copied to clipboard!

Inżynier iOS

Opis

Text copied to clipboard!
Poszukujemy doświadczonego Inżyniera iOS, który dołączy do naszego zespołu rozwijającego nowoczesne aplikacje mobilne. Idealny kandydat będzie odpowiedzialny za projektowanie, rozwój i utrzymanie aplikacji na system iOS, współpracując z zespołem projektowym, backendowym oraz testerami. Twoja praca będzie miała bezpośredni wpływ na doświadczenie użytkowników naszych produktów mobilnych. Jako Inżynier iOS będziesz uczestniczyć w pełnym cyklu życia aplikacji – od koncepcji, przez projektowanie i implementację, aż po testowanie i publikację w App Store. Oczekujemy znajomości języka Swift oraz środowiska Xcode, a także doświadczenia w pracy z bibliotekami zewnętrznymi i narzędziami do zarządzania zależnościami, takimi jak CocoaPods lub Swift Package Manager. Ważna jest dla nas umiejętność pracy zespołowej, komunikatywność oraz chęć ciągłego rozwoju. Pracujemy w metodyce Agile, dlatego cenimy elastyczność i samodzielność w działaniu. Oferujemy możliwość pracy zdalnej, elastyczne godziny pracy, a także udział w ciekawych projektach realizowanych dla klientów z różnych branż. Jeśli jesteś pasjonatem technologii mobilnych, masz doświadczenie w tworzeniu aplikacji iOS i chcesz rozwijać się w dynamicznym środowisku, zapraszamy do aplikowania!

Obowiązki

Text copied to clipboard!
  • Projektowanie i rozwój aplikacji mobilnych na iOS
  • Współpraca z zespołem projektowym i backendowym
  • Integracja z API i usługami zewnętrznymi
  • Testowanie i debugowanie aplikacji
  • Publikacja aplikacji w App Store
  • Utrzymanie i aktualizacja istniejących aplikacji
  • Optymalizacja wydajności aplikacji
  • Udział w przeglądach kodu i wdrażaniu najlepszych praktyk
  • Tworzenie dokumentacji technicznej
  • Współpraca w metodyce Agile/Scrum

Wymagania

Text copied to clipboard!
  • Minimum 2 lata doświadczenia w tworzeniu aplikacji iOS
  • Bardzo dobra znajomość języka Swift
  • Znajomość środowiska Xcode i narzędzi Apple
  • Doświadczenie z bibliotekami zewnętrznymi (np. Alamofire, Realm)
  • Znajomość wzorców projektowych i architektury MVVM/MVC
  • Umiejętność pracy z systemem kontroli wersji Git
  • Znajomość zasad projektowania UI/UX
  • Doświadczenie w pracy zespołowej
  • Znajomość języka angielskiego na poziomie technicznym
  • Chęć nauki i rozwoju zawodowego

Potencjalne pytania na rozmowie

Text copied to clipboard!
  • Jakie masz doświadczenie w pracy z językiem Swift?
  • Czy publikowałeś aplikacje w App Store? Jeśli tak, podaj przykłady.
  • Z jakimi bibliotekami zewnętrznymi miałeś okazję pracować?
  • Jakie wzorce projektowe stosujesz w swoich aplikacjach?
  • Czy masz doświadczenie w pracy w metodyce Agile?
  • Jak radzisz sobie z debugowaniem i testowaniem aplikacji?
  • Czy masz doświadczenie w pracy z API REST?
  • Jakie są Twoje oczekiwania względem rozwoju zawodowego?
  • Czy pracowałeś wcześniej z zespołem zdalnym?
  • Jakie narzędzia wykorzystujesz do zarządzania zależnościami?